What is CVE-2019-11658?
This vulnerability in Micro Focus Content Manager versions 9.1, 9.2, and 9.3 exposes sensitive information under specific conditions when integrated with an Oracle database. Valid system users may inadvertently gain access to limited records outside their normal permissions due to the system's abnormal state.
